What seemed like only a heartbeat, seasons had changed, the creatures laying within the lands entering the cycle of rebirth along with the greenery filling out the dead trees and empty landscapes. So young he had been in his last spring that the very simplicity of the season fascinated him and invigorated him to push himself more, to try and learn something new with all the changes and new starts going on around him. Rolling his shoulders, he pulled mismatched arms above his head, fingers intertwined as he stretched the muscles in his arms, mouth opening as he let out a lazy yawn, green eyes squinting shut in a comical way as he did so. If he was asked to describe his current lifestyle, it would be simplistic, boring and repetitive.

Crouching down outside of the small cabin he called him, the lad plucked up his bag, shrugging it into his place over his shoulders, lifting the flap to confirm it's current contents. From a glance he could see the small knife he used for skinning, various hooks and scrap metal he had picked up at some point without having noticed. Closing the bag he reached out and picked up his spear which was leaned against the cabins wooden wall. With his typical gear gathered he proceeded to the village, spear being used as a temporary walking stick, his left hand shoved in the front pocket of his recently acquired black cargo trousers; they hadn't initially been black, but some horrid vibrant colour. It had taken him awhile to patch them up and dye them, making them to the point he could wear them out in public and not be a laughing stock.

“Lokni, coming?” he asked, eyes watching the darkness of the cabin to see if the guide was planning on following him. After a moment of silence, the panther slunk out of the cabin, repeating his charge's notion of stretching out and yawning. Walking in companionable silence, the pain quickly made their way to the village, the lad in search of someone whom could either aid him with hunting or carving.
